Transaction 652f56c59697368e9cd157e12a50f17221bc8cb1644a9b74ea5cd7afad0ae84c
1 Input
1 Output
-
652f56c59697368e9cd157e12a50f17221bc8cb1644a9b74ea5cd7afad0ae84c:0
- value
- 1347784
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3815997514d69792398bcd8b067f5cd58990b9f
- address
- bc1qcwq4n963f45hjguchnvtqel4e4vfjzulqcy0zz